CMU Scholarships for New Students

Many scholarships are available to CMU students in recognition of their outstanding academic and/or leadership achievement.

Scholarships

Here is a partial listing. Other scholarships are available through individual CMU departments. Consult the Bulletin or contact your chosen department for more information.

Click on a scholarship below to view more information.

  • Centralis Scholarship Program
    • CMU’s highest merit-based scholarship awards
    • Open to all Michigan high school students with a 3.5 GPA or higher
    • 20 Centralis Scholar Awards equal to the cost of tuition, room and board and a $500 allowance toward the cost of books and supplies
    • 20 Centralis Gold Awards equal to the cost of tuition
    • Both awards are renewable for three additional consecutive years if student maintains a minimum 3.25 GPA and full-time enrollment
    • Applications are sent to qualifying students in the fall and are available from guidance counselors
  • Outstanding High School Student Scholarship
    • Open to high school seniors who rank first or second in their high school graduating class
    • No application necessary – qualifying students will automatically receive this award
    • $4,000 per academic year
    • Renewable for three additional consecutive years if student maintains a minimum 3.25 GPA and full-time enrollment
    • Centralis Scholarship replaces this award
    • Reside in our on-campus residence halls in both your freshman and sophomore years unless granted an exception by the Office of Residence Life
  • Academic Honors Scholarship
    • Open to high school seniors with both a minimum 3.5 GPA and an ACT score of at least 20
    • No application necessary – qualifying students will automatically receive this award
    • $2,500 per academic year
    • Renewable for three additional consecutive years if student maintains a minimum 3.25 GPA and full-time enrollment
    • Centralis Scholarship and Outstanding High School Student Scholarship replace this award
    • Reside in our on-campus residence halls in both your freshman and sophomore years unless granted an exception by the Office of Residence Life
  • CMU Leader Advancement Scholarship Program
    • Awarded to 40 outstanding Michigan high school seniors who have distinguished themselves through a record of leadership in their schools and communities
    • Selected by committee based on application and portfolio
    • Applicants must have a minimum 3.0 GPA
    • $2,000 per academic year
    • Renewable for three additional consecutive years if student maintains a minimum 2.75 GPA and full-time enrollment
    • Reside in our on-campus residence halls in both your freshman and sophomore years unless granted an exception by the Office of Residence Life

  • Lloyd M. Cofer Scholarships
    • Awarded to up to 10 incoming graduates of a Detroit public high school
    • $4,125 per academic year
    • Renewable for three additional consecutive years if student maintains full-time enrollment and a satisfactory academic record

  • CMU Multicultural Advancement Scholarships
    • Awarded to up to 44 Michigan high school graduates who demonstrate an interest in the advancement of minorities in American society
    • $4,125 per academic year
    • Renewable for three additional consecutive years if student maintains full-time enrollment and a satisfactory academic record
    • Reside in our on-campus residence halls in both your freshman and sophomore years unless granted an exception by the Office of Residence Life

  • CMU Multicultural Advancement Award of Distinction
    • Awarded to up to 10 incoming freshmen
    • $10,500 per academic year to be used toward the cost of tuition, fees, room and board, books and supplies
    • Renewable for three additional consecutive years if student maintains a minimum 3.25 GPA and full-time enrollment
    • Reside in our on-campus residence halls in both your freshman and sophomore years unless granted an exception by the Office of Residence Life

  • CMU President’s Award
    • Open to non-Michigan resident high school seniors with a minimum 2.75 GPA
    • Equal to the difference between in-state and out-of-state tuition for the academic year
    • Renewable for new freshmen for three additional consecutive years if student maintains a minimum 2.5GPA, non-Michigan residency and full-time enrollment
    • Participation in the Legacy Program replaces this award
    • Reside in our on-campus residence halls both your freshman and sophomore years unless granted an exception by the Office of Residence Life

Qualifications

  • Recipients of CMU merit- and talent-based scholarships equal to or greater than $2,000 are required to reside on campus during their freshman and sophomore years unless they qualify as commuting students or for another exception to the Campus Residency Policy.
  • Students may receive up to two renewable merit scholarships. Students who are selected for more than two renewable scholarships may choose the awards of highest value.
